John Hilton's are delighted to be able to offer as sole agent a rare opportunity to acquire this charming one-bedroom period conversion which is favourably located in the highly desirable area of Fiveways with its array of popular local amenities, coffee shops, cafes and independent shops - it really does tick all the boxes. The property occupies the entire lower ground floor of this attractive converted house and benefits from its own private entrance, a share of the freehold, ample storage, a cute private enclosed front courtyard and wonderful far-reaching views which can be enjoyed from the impressive "quiet, green oasis" private rear garden. The garden has been thoughtfully arranged over four levels and boasts a substantial timber cabin with power, lighting and generous decked terrace. The property is considered to be in good decorative order throughout and includes a dual aspect lounge/dining room, modern fitted kitchen and bathroom with tub and window. Ideally located for a great selection of independent cafes, shops and amenities and easy access to Preston Park and local train station.

Approach - Steps descend to front patio with timber door to understairs storage. Obscure double glazed front door with outside light opening into:

Entrance Porch - Storage area, obscure glazed timber-framed door to front courtyard and further part-obscure glazed UPVC door into:

Kitchen - 4.08m x 1.66m (13'4" x 5'5") - Modern fitted kitchen offering a range of matching wall and base units. Work surfaces extend to include a four-ring gas hob and single bowl sink with drainer and mixer tap, electric oven with extractor over, and space and plumbing for a washing machine and fridge freezer. High-level cupboards housing electric fuse box and gas meter, vinyl floor, coved ceiling with inset downlights, radiator and part-double glazed door to rear garden with cat flap.

Lounge/Dining Room - 4.06m x 3.38m (13'3" x 11'1") - Dual aspect with double glazed windows to front and rear, radiator, coved ceiling.

Bathroom - Obscure double glazed window to front, panel-enclosed bath with electric shower over and glass shower screen, pedestal wash hand basin with tiled splashback and low-level WC. Part-tiled walls, wall-mounted shelving and mirrored bathroom cabinet, heated towel rail, coved ceiling.

Bedroom - 3.20m x 2.49m (10'5" x 8'2") - Double glazed window to rear with radiator under, laminate flooring, built-in cupboard housing 'Worcester' combi boiler, coved ceiling.

Front Courtyard - Wall-enclosed and laid to artificial grass.

Rear Garden - Upper West-facing terrace laid to artificial grass with timber fence and outside tap. Timber stairs descend to further decked terrace with brick-retained planters and expansive timber veranda with outside power and large timber-built cabin comprising two sections with double glazed windows, timber floorboards, power and lighting. Timber stairs continue down to an area laid to lawn with flower borders, and then continue down again to lowest tier housing timber shed with power and lighting and three water butts.
